BD DIESEL PERFORMANCE 1045828 Features:
The drop-in, stock-appearing Screamer turbo for the later model Ford 6.7L Powerstroke utilizes modern turbo technology that delivers increased airflow without compromising on low end response. Boost pressure can be increased to improve horsepower potential. The Powerstroke Screamer turbo works with any "box" tuner and further improvements achieved with custom tuning. Drop-in turbo includes the updated 2017-2019 pedestal, coolant line and gaskets for a drop-in replacement on your 2015-2016 vehicle.- 64.0mm Billet compressor wheel
- Custom mixed flow turbine (MFT) wheel with a large 65mm exducer
- Drop-in stock-appearing turbo
- Increased airflow without compromising on low end drivability
- Large 65mm “mixed flow? turbine wheel increases turbine flow and retains efficiency
- More boost, lower drive pressure, and lower EGT?(TM) s
- No tuning required and does not set engine codes
- Up to 81lb/min of airflow
- VSR high speed balanced
- Includes updated pedestal and coolant tube for a drop-in install
- Built using a brand new Garrett Turbo
